Welcome to Elder Middle School!

Nestled in the vibrant heart of Fort Worth, Texas, Elder Middle School is a cornerstone of academic excellence and community spirit at 709 NW 21ST. As a proud member of Fort Worth ISD, our school is dedicated to fostering a nurturing environment where every student thrives.

Why Choose Elder Middle School?

Experienced Faculty: At Elder, we boast a dedicated team of 61 teachers who average a commendable 10 years of experience in the education field, with a stable average tenure at the school of 8 years. This wealth of experience ensures that our educators bring both wisdom and innovative teaching methods into the classroom, providing an enriched learning experience for all students.

Optimal Learning Environment: With a current enrollment of 955 students, our student-to-teacher ratio stands at an impressive 15.70. This allows for personalized attention and tailored instruction, ensuring that each student's unique needs and potential are adequately met.

Supportive Staff: In addition to our skilled teachers, we are supported by 6 dedicated educational aids who contribute significantly to our nurturing educational environment. This team works hand-in-hand to create a supportive and inclusive atmosphere that promotes learning and personal growth.

Dynamic Curriculum and Extracurricular Activities: Elder Middle School offers a diverse curriculum designed to challenge and inspire our students, preparing them for high school and beyond. Our extracurricular activities provide numerous opportunities for students to explore their interests and talents, fostering a well-rounded educational experience.

Community and Involvement: Located in the dynamic area of Fort Worth, Elder Middle School benefits from a strong sense of community involvement. We believe in the power of partnership between the school and the community, which enhances our programs and enriches our students' educational journey.
